Developing prototypes during the design phase is critically important and should always answer important questions such as:
- Has the product been designed using solid design principles?
- What are the costs associated with the products lifecycle?
- What are most efficient methods to manufacture the product?
- What materials can be considered for production, and what is the cost-to-quality ratio of each?
- How long will it take to manufacture the final product?
- How much will each unit cost to produce?

Design and Manufacturing
Design for manufacturability (DFM), design for assembly (DFA), and the concept of lean manufacturing all play vital roles in our product design, development and manufacturing process.
Read on to see how each of theses concepts are applied to our product engineering process.
Design for Manufacturability
Design for manufacturability or DFM is the practice of designing products that are able to be easily manufactured.
A parts producibility or ‘the measure of the relative ease of manufacturing’ will drastically affect the costs associated to produce it.
Design for manufacturing aims to simplify the manufacturing of each part.
The design stage is the best time to address and fine tune such details as material types, material forms, tolerances, designs and shapes.
Design for Assembly
Design for assembly or DFA is simply a method of analyzing the assembly processes of components and their sub-assemblies.
When utilizing DFA, efforts are taken to optimize the process steps needed during assembly, identify part relevance, and estimate the final cost of assembly.
Using DFA will minimize assembly costs by optimizing the assembly process and reducing the total number of parts needed.
Lean Manufacturing
What is lean manufacturing and how does it apply to the manufacturing of my product?
Lean manufacturing or just ‘lean’ as it is sometimes known is a product design engineering concept that comes to us from the Far East.
Lean is a method of analyzing a process and eliminating any wasteful actions.
By eliminating wasteful efforts in this manner we will only be left with ‘that which adds value’.
A focus on adding value and eliminating waste in the production chain has the benefit of increasing quality, speeding delivery times and helping to reduce overall costs.
